Is an excellent method for preventing photoaging

We age in two ways: chronologically and photochemically. Chronological aging is the normal process that happens as we age, whereas photoaging occurs when a person seems considerably older than they are.

Unprotected exposure to damaging UVA/UVB rays, as well as other forms of free radicals, is the primary cause of this type of aging. Watermelon is a rich source of antioxidants, and drinking a glass of fresh watermelon juice protects your skin from environmental aggressors.

It may be used as a natural facial mist

Another excellent option to incorporate watermelon juice into your beauty routine is to use it as a refreshing face spray. Don’t worry if you don’t know where to buy one; here’s how to make your own DIY watermelon facial mist in no time:

Step 1: To begin, squeeze around two teaspoons of fresh watermelon juice. Refrigerate for about an hour before continuing with the recipe.

Step 02: To this watermelon juice, add around a tablespoon of fresh coconut water.

Step 03: Stir in roughly a tablespoon of witch hazel until all of the ingredients are well combined.

Step 04: Put this toner in a spray bottle and apply it whenever your face appears to be unusually greasy or in need of a fast pick-me-up.

Note: Keep this DIY watermelon juice face mist refrigerated to maintain its freshness. If you carry it with you during the day, at the very least keep it refrigerated overnight. If you take this small precaution, this fantastic face mist will last for up to two weeks.

Watermelon juice face mask

Face masks are all the rage in the skincare industry, and we believe they deserve their time in the limelight. This is due to the fact that face masks include great skin-loving substances that give focused action, treat particular skin disorders, and eradicate the problem at its source. And a watermelon juice face mask will accomplish the same thing.

If you have dry, dull, or lackluster skin that needs to be rejuvenated, this DIY face mask is the answer. Watermelon’s calming and moisturizing characteristics will quickly refresh, rejuvenate, and revitalize your skin, leaving it looking incredibly fresh and beautiful in no time. Here’s how to make it.

Step 1: Squeeze half a cup of freshly squeezed watermelon juice. Make sure you’re not utilizing canned or boxed versions, as they could not be as effective.

Step 02: To this juice, add a spoonful of fresh, creamy yogurt and combine the two ingredients.

Step 03: Using a clean face brush, apply this mask to your entire face and neck region and let it on for 30 minutes.

Step 04: After it has dried, wash it with water, a light soap, and lukewarm water.

Step 05: Apply your favorite moisturiser to seal in the moisture.
